# PR #3945: fix(B-0441): re-open per parent-child status invariant (B-0532)

## PR description

## Summary

Restores B-0441 to `status: open` to satisfy the `--enforce-parent-child-status` lint (B-0532 gate). PR #3942 closed B-0441 while child B-0460 (slice 5.2 — subscriber handler) was still open; the lint failure surfaced this correctly but auto-merge fired anyway because the lint check isn't in the required-checks list.

This PR brings origin/main back to parent-child consistency.

## Why the previous close was wrong

The 2026-05-16 acceptance-refresh PR (#3942) marked 6 stale unchecked acceptance boxes as `[x]` correctly — the notifier-side IS fully implemented. But it ALSO flipped `status: closed`, which violated the parent-child invariant because `children: [B-0500, B-0501, B-0502, B-0460]` includes one open child (B-0460).

The audit output was unambiguous:

```
## 9. Parent-child status mismatch (B-0532)
Parent-child status-mismatch groups: 1
- B-0441 (closed) has open children:
- Re-open the parent if the children represent unfinished work, OR
- Remove the child refs from the parent's `children:` if they no longer apply
error: 1 parent-child status-mismatch group(s) found; --enforce-parent-child-status set (B-0532 gate)
```

I picked "re-open the parent" because B-0460 IS unfinished work (subscriber handler scope is genuinely different from notifier scope; both lanes are legitimate).

## Diff

- `docs/backlog/P1/B-0441-*.md`:
- `status: closed` → `status: open` (one line)
- Added a new `## Closure status (2026-05-16)` section explaining notifier-side is complete (acceptance refresh stands) but row stays open per parent-child invariant until B-0460 lands
- `docs/BACKLOG.md`: regenerated — flips back `[x] → [ ]` for B-0441 line

## Test plan

- [ ] `lint (backlog parent-child status)` passes (verified locally: 0 mismatch groups)
- [ ] Audit doesn't surface any new violations
- [ ] When B-0460 lands later, a follow-up PR can flip B-0441 to closed without further substrate work

## Open question for human maintainer

The `lint (backlog parent-child status)` check failed on PR #3942 but auto-merge fired anyway. This suggests the check is NOT in the required-checks list. If parent-child consistency matters (the B-0532 design implies it does), the check should likely be required. That's a separate decision — flagging for awareness, not addressing here.

### Thread 5: docs/backlog/P1/B-0441-backlog-row-ready-to-grind-notifier-background-service-2026-05-13.md:188 (resolved)

**@copilot-pull-request-reviewer** (2026-05-16T21:40:20Z):

P1: The closure note “When B-0501 and B-0460 land and close, this row is ready to flip to closed” appears incomplete given the enforced parent/child invariant: all children must be in a closed status. Today B-0502 is `status: shipped` (not one of the documented closed statuses in tools/backlog/README.md, and not treated as closed by tools/hygiene/audit-backlog-items.ts), so closing B-0441 later would still fail unless B-0502 is also moved to a closed status (or the closed-status set is updated). Clarify this in the closure guidance.

**@AceHack** (2026-05-16T22:20:37Z):

Verified — `shipped` is NOT in `CLOSED_STATUSES` (`{closed, landed, superseded, merged, done}` per `tools/hygiene/audit-backlog-items.ts:245`) and is NOT in the documented enum (`open / closed / superseded-by-B-NNNN / deferred / decomposed` per `tools/backlog/README.md:63`). Closure guidance updated in d0ea0581: line 188 now flags the B-0502 `shipped` status mismatch explicitly and names the two resolution paths (flip B-0502 to a documented closed status, OR extend `CLOSED_STATUSES` + README enum to recognize `shipped`).
